Subramanian Swamy writes ‘Russia is not a friend of India’, Russian Embassy says, ‘not just friends, but Russia is a soulmate of India’: Details

The Russian Embassy in India has denounced the article penned by Dr Subramanian Swamy in the Sunday Guardian on October 31, 2020, in which he argued that Russia is no longer a friend that India could trust in its conflict against China.

A statement titled “Russia is not just a friend-but a soulmate of India” was released by the Russian Embassy, which was also shared on its official social media pages. In its statement, the Russian Embassy has expressed its “regrets” over Swamy’s article, adding that it provided a misleading view of the true understanding of the entire course of development, current state and prospects of the Russian-Indian strategic partnership.

Assailing the article, the Russian embassy’s statement read that the essay “demonstrated a lack of knowledge of the modern Russian realities that equates relevant assessments in the article with the geopolitically motivated groundless and biased approach by some Western news agencies”.

It further added that Russia enjoys productive and trusted relations with all the political parties in the country. Be it Congress, when the early bilateral relations between the two countries were established or the current ruling regime BJP, under the aegis of former PM Atal Bihari Vajpayee, a rule the Declaration of the Strategic Partnership was signed between the two countries, the post said.

The Russian Embassy also mentioned that under the “Make in India” and “Atmanirbhar Bharat” initiatives, the two countries are on an unparalleled joint endeavour in the nuclear power sector or trusted defence cooperation with real technology transfer, advanced localization of production and even cooperation with third countries.

“Coinciding global priorities make Russia and India truly likeminded. Our multilateral partnership in the framework of #G20, #BRICS, #SCO, etc. is based on the solid ground of our common priority to proceed towards just and the equal multipolar world with the central role of the United Nations and international law as well as undivided security,” the statement further read.

Regarding the Indo-Sino border standoff, Russia encouraged the two countries to resolve the dispute through constructive dialogue. The statement noted that disagreements between India and China have provided some “dishonest elements” with an opportunity to drive a wedge between the bilateral relations.

“So, the Russian-Indian ties are unique, and they cannot be harmed by a single misleading article, which by no means have any link to the reality and, of course, doesn’t reflect any official position,” the statement concluded.

Russia will align with China to revive its power and prestige: Dr Subramanian Swamy

In his scathing article, Dr Subramanian Swamy raised apprehensions over Russia’s commitment to friendship with India. Swamy alleged in his article that Russia can no longer be trusted as it sees collaboration with China as the only path to the revival of Kremlin’s prestige and power.

Swamy claims in his article that Russia is a “junior partner” of China, stating that Russia acts keeping in mind the interests of China. Swamy added that India’s growing reliance on Russia for the weapons is dangerous, considering the Chinese electronics used in their making and the close bond shared between Russian president Vladimir Putin and Chinese Premier Xi Jinping. Recently, Russia had also announced that “could enter into a military alliance with China”.

The firebrand politician also sharply noted that Nehru was fooled into believing that Russia was India’s closest ally. “Nehru was fooled into thinking that leaders in Moscow were permanent friends, but in fact, we Indians were more like “Pavlovian dogs”, that is, those who complied on signals from Moscow,” Swamy stated.

Swamy asserts that if India has a conflict with China, it can no longer trust Russia. He said that the dream of isolating China through Russia is myopic and concluded that “Russia is no more a friend of India in the sense of standing up with India against China”.

As CBI opposes FIR, Mumbai Police says they are probing if Sushant Singh Rajput mental health deteriorated after sisters’ medical prescription

Almost five months on, the Sushant Singh Rajput’s death case is nowhere near to closure. Every second day a new aspect appears in the case, which needs further investigation. Days after the CBI opposed an FIR filed against Sushant Singh Rajput’s sisters on Rhea Chakraborty’s complaint in the Bombay High Court, the Mumbai Police on Monday told Bombay High Court that Sushant Singh Rajput’s mental health may have deteriorated after his sisters gave him medicines.

Defending the registration of FIR against Sushant Singh Rajput’s sisters at the behest of actor Rhea Chakraborty, Mumbai police stated in an affidavit before the Bombay High Court that the concerned police officer at Bandra police station was duty-bound to register the FIR after receiving information for commission of a cognisable offence as per provisions of Section 154 of CrPC.

Bandra Police’s senior inspector Nikhil Kapse in the affidavit submitted in Bombay HC refuted the allegations that the Mumbai police were damaging the reputation of the petitioners (Sushant Singh Rajput’s two sisters in this case) or any deceased person (the actor). 

Mumbai police seek dismissal of the petition filed by sisters of Sushant Singh Rajput to quash FIR against them

Seeking dismissal of the petition filed by Sushant Singh Rajput’s two sisters-Priyanka Singh and Meetu Singh to quash the first information report (FIR) lodged against them for alleged forgery and fabrication of a medical prescription for their brother, the Mumbai police said in court: “FIR lodged at Mumbai seeks investigation into the alleged offence of conspiracy, forgery, cheating and conspiracy by petitioners sisters of Sushant Singh Rajput, Dr Tarun Kumar and others for fabricating medical prescription to procure and administer controlled drugs/psychotropic substances to Sushant Singh Rajput without his actual examination. FIR also seeks investigations into the possibility of deterioration of his mental health and eventual suicide pursuant to the said conspiracy.”

The Mumbai police argued in Bombay HC that the FIR against Priyanka and Meetu was registered based on the information provided by the first informant (Rhea Chakraborty), therefore the Mumbai police were not trying to “influence or derail” the probe being carried out by the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) by registering the FIR against Rajput’s sisters.

CBI opposes FIR filed by Mumbai police against actor’s sisters

On October 28, CBI, which is currently probing the death case of the actor had told Bombay HC that the FIR filed by Mumbai police against Sushant Singh Rajput’s sisters for allegedly forging and procuring a fake medical prescription for their brother was “vitiated and bad in law”.

The CBI made the arguments in response to a plea filed by Rajput’s sisters – Priyanka Singh and Mitu Singh – seeking to quash the case lodged against them by the Mumbai Police. The FIR was filed based on actor Rhea Chakraborty’s complaint.

Rhea Chakraborty alleged sisters fabricated medical prescription of actor Sushant Singh Rajput

On September 7, Rhea Chakraborty had filed a complaint against the actor’s sisters, alleging that they used a fabricated medical prescription to help him procure medicines banned under the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ances Act, only a few days before his death. She also named a doctor of the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ital in Delhi, Tarun Kumar, who allegedly signed the prescription claiming that Sushant died just days after taking the medicines that were ‘prescribed’ by Dr Kumar.

Bihar Assembly elections: Onions pelted at Nitish Kumar’s poll rally at Madhubani’s Harlakhi

While the second phase of the crucial Bihar Assembly elections are underway, the chief minister of Bihar, Nitish Kumar, was greeted with onions during his election rally at Madhubani’s Harlakhi Vidhan Sabha Constituency.

Shortly after Nitish Kumar assumed the podium, making a pitch to the people to vote for his party and alliance, some miscreants in the crowd started hurling onions at the JDU chief. The security guard quickly came forward and flanked the chief minister to defend him from the attack.

However, Kumar remained unfazed with the onions hurled at him and persisted with his speech, asking people to continue attacking him. Kumar was speaking on unemployment when he was attacked by an unidentified man with onions.

The man who had reportedly hurled onions at Kumar kept shouting that though alcohol is prohibited in the state, it is freely being sold and available everywhere.

This is not the first time that Kumar had to endure an embarrassing attack by the audience in his election rally. Earlier in the past, crowds in his election rallies were heard booing him while shouting slogans in support of the RJD.

The second phase of Bihar polls currently underway

The second phase of the Bihar Assembly elections is currently underway in 94 constituencies across 17 districts of the state. The Nitish Kumar-led Janata Dal (United) is contesting on 43 seats, while its NDA ally BJP is fighting it out 46 seats. Mukesh Sahni’s VIP is contesting the remaining five. On the other hand, RJD is contesting on 56 seats and its partner Congress is battling it out on 24 constituencies. The CPI and CPI(M) are fighting four seats each. The LJP is contesting 52 seats, including the two it had won in 2015 contesting as an NDA constituent.

The districts that are going to polls are Patna, Bhagalpur, Nalanda, West Champaran, East Champaran, Madhubani, Darbhanga, Muzaffarpur, Sheohar, Sitamarhi, Gopalganj, Vaishali, Samastipur, Begusarai, Siwan, Saran and Khagaria.

Among the key faces in this phase of elections are the fodder scam convict Lalu Prasad Yadav’s two sons—Tejashwi Pratap Yadav and Tej Pratap Yadav.
